Implementing robust geospatial caching strategies to accelerate common analytics queries across large raster and vector sets.
Geospatial caching approaches are essential for speeding up repeated analyses, yet they require careful design, scalable storage, and adaptive invalidation to handle diverse raster and vector workloads effectively.
July 27, 2025
Facebook X Reddit
As geospatial analytics increasingly hinges on speed and scale, caching emerges as a cornerstone technique that reduces repetitive computation, minimizes latency, and stabilizes throughput across diverse query patterns. The practice encompasses both raster and vector data, recognizing that each data type presents distinct access characteristics. For rasters, tile-based caches enable rapid retrieval of frequently requested regions, while pyramid layers support multi-resolution queries without recomputation. Vector caches focus on repeating spatial predicates, neighborhood queries, and topology-heavy operations, often leveraging prepared geometries and spatial indexes. A well-structured caching layer can dramatically improve response times for dashboards, batch jobs, and interactive analytics alike.
Building robust geospatial caches begins with clarity about workload characteristics, including typical query envelopes, resolution preferences, and update frequencies. It also requires selecting storage that balances speed with capacity, latency with consistency, and hot data with archival tiers. In practice, designers deploy a multi-tier strategy that combines in-memory caches for the hottest tiles and geometries, on-disk caches for near-term reuse, and distributed caches for large-scale deployments. Observability matters: instrumentation should reveal cache hit rates, eviction patterns, and dependency graphs so teams can pinpoint bottlenecks and adjust weights, TTLs, and invalidation rules accordingly.
Cache design balances speed, scale, and data fidelity across formats.
The first principle centers on locality: caches should exploit spatial and temporal locality by organizing data around common geographic extents and stable query paths. Effective tiling schemes align tile size with typical viewport dimensions and analytic extents, minimizing the number of tiles fetched per operation. For vector data, preprocessing steps such as simplifying complex geometries and precomputing topologies reduce CPU work during cache retrieval. An adaptive TTL model helps ensure freshness without overburdening the system with constant recomputation. These practices enable faster map rendering, analytics dashboards, and iterative spatial modeling workflows.
ADVERTISEMENT
ADVERTISEMENT
The second principle concerns coherence and consistency, ensuring that cached results remain trustworthy as underlying data evolves. Implementing invalidation strategies that respond to updates, deletions, or schema changes prevents stale responses from polluting analyses. Use event-driven invalidation when possible, triggering cache refreshes only for affected tiles or geometries. In distributed environments, consistency across nodes becomes critical, so synchronization protocols, version stamps, and atomic refresh operations help maintain uniform views. Balancing immediacy and overhead requires careful experimentation, but the payoff is a cache that confidently reflects the current state of the dataset.
Practical techniques accelerate repeated spatial queries efficiently.
A practical caching architecture blends in-memory speed with durable persistence, then layers in a distributed layer to span geography and workload spikes. For raster workloads, consider a hybrid approach where hot tiles reside in RAM caches on edge nodes, while larger tiers reside in fast SSDs or clustered object storage. For vector assets, cache prepared geometries, indices, and spatial predicates to cut repetitive processing costs. The cache should expose a simple API for cacheable operations, enabling analytics engines to transparently reuse results. Instrumentation at each layer—latency, hit rate, and error budgets—drives continued improvement and informs capacity planning.
ADVERTISEMENT
ADVERTISEMENT
Beyond storage, compute-aware caching supports smarter reuse by storing not just raw results, but also partial computations and query plans. For instance, caching a bounding box index or a precomputed spatial join result can turn expensive operations into near-instant lookups. Reuse is particularly beneficial for recurring patterns such as proximity searches, overlap queries, and zonal statistics. As data volumes grow, it becomes essential to track dependency graphs so that when a base dataset updates, dependent caches are invalidated automatically. This holistic approach prevents cascading recomputations and sustains interactive performance.
Resilience and governance strengthen long-term cache viability.
Geospatial indexing remains foundational to fast retrieval, enabling rapid candidate filtering before any heavy computation. Spatial indexes like R-trees or hierarchical grids partition space to shrink the search space dramatically. Combining such indexes with tiling accelerates raster and vector queries alike by limiting the number of features touched. Precomputing summaries, such as minimum bounding boxes or area-weighted statistics, reduces the need to scan entire layers for common analytics. When implemented thoughtfully, indexing in concert with caching yields predictable latency under varying data distribution, which is crucial for time-sensitive decision making.
Partitioning and replication strategies influence cache performance across large, multi-user environments. Geographic partitioning aligns caches with data locality, ensuring that user requests rarely traverse long network paths. Replication of hot caches to regional hubs minimizes cross-cloud traffic and enhances resilience. Cache warming, where anticipated workloads prefill caches during idle windows, helps avoid cold starts following deployments or traffic surges. Monitoring tools should flag imbalanced partitions or skewed access patterns, prompting redistribution or replication adjustments. Together, these practices promote steadier performance as datasets expand and user bases grow.
ADVERTISEMENT
ADVERTISEMENT
Organization and culture support scalable geospatial caching adoption.
Robust geospatial caches must tolerate partial failures and degradations without cascading impact on analytics. Redundancy at multiple levels—in-memory, on-disk, and across nodes—mitigates data loss and keeps services available during outages. Health checks, automatic failover, and graceful degradation help maintain user experience when capacity is temporarily constrained. Data lineage and provenance tracking enable auditors to verify cached results against source data, supporting reproducibility and trust. Regularly scheduled audits, coupled with automated tests for cache correctness, guard against subtle inconsistencies that can creep into complex spatial pipelines over time.
Governance extends to lifecycle management, defining when to refresh, purge, or retire caches as business needs shift. Policies should specify acceptable staleness windows for various analytics scenarios, balancing accuracy with performance. Automated purging based on usage patterns prevents caches from becoming unwieldy, while archival strategies preserve historical results for retrospective analyses. Versioning cached outputs guarantees traceability when datasets evolve, and rollback mechanisms offer safety if a new cache configuration underperforms. A well-governed cache ecosystem reduces risk and supports sustainable analytics workloads.
Successful adoption hinges on cross-disciplinary collaboration among data engineers, GIS analysts, and operations teams. Clear ownership, documented interfaces, and shared metrics align goals and accelerate iteration. Training programs help analysts understand when to rely on cached results versus recomputing, preventing overdependence on preprocessing. Establishing a runbook for cache tuning—covering TTLs, eviction policies, and index strategies—empowers teams to respond quickly to shifting data and demand. A culture of observability ensures observable performance, enabling proactive adjustments rather than reactive firefighting in response to latency spikes.
As with most robust systems, gradual experimentation yields the best long-term gains, supplemented by scalable tooling and standardized patterns. Start with a minimal viable caching layer that covers popular queries, then incrementally extend to additional data types and operations. Use synthetic workloads to stress-test eviction and refresh strategies before production. Document decisions, monitor outcomes, and adjust configurations in small, reversible steps. With disciplined design and continuous learning, geospatial caching becomes a durable accelerator for analytics, unlocking deeper insights from ever-growing raster and vector collections.
Related Articles
This evergreen exploration explains how spatial equilibrium models illuminate the tangled relationships among where people live, how they travel, and how easy it is to reach jobs, services, and amenities, fostering better urban planning decisions grounded in data.
August 07, 2025
A practical guide to building federated geospatial analytics platforms that foster cross-organization collaboration, scale securely, and maintain rigorous data privacy, governance, and ethical considerations across diverse partners.
July 17, 2025
A holistic exploration of how spatial multi-criteria decision analysis can guide equitable brownfield revitalization by weighing environmental risk, community need, accessibility, and economic impact to maximize public benefit.
July 19, 2025
This evergreen guide explains how spatial attribution analyzes pollution origins, supports targeted regulation, and guides remediation by mapping sources, tracking pathways, and informing community-centered environmental action and policy design.
July 21, 2025
This evergreen guide details practical strategies for tuning algorithms by incorporating geographic context, enabling robust performance across diverse regions, climates, and data collection environments while maintaining model stability and fairness.
July 19, 2025
Crowdsourced geographic data holds promise for rapid disaster mapping, yet reliability hinges on robust quality assessment, metadata standards, and transparent processing pipelines that empower responders to act decisively under pressure.
July 22, 2025
A practical guide to building validation approaches for spatial models, emphasizing autocorrelation, sampling bias, and robust, reproducible assessment strategies across diverse geographic datasets.
July 29, 2025
This guide explains how geospatial scenario ensembles illuminate resilience gaps, guiding planners to stress-test infrastructure with diverse spatial contingencies, data fusion, and robust decision frameworks.
July 15, 2025
This evergreen exploration explains how transfer learning bridges geographic domains to speed up reliable mapping when data is sparse, revealing strategies, caveats, and practical pathways for diverse landscapes.
July 17, 2025
A practical, evergreen exploration of spatial treatment effect methods that reveal how local programs influence nearby regions, how spillovers occur, and how interference can be measured, modeled, and interpreted for policy insight.
July 15, 2025
This article explores how network flow optimization and geospatial demand insights can transform last-mile operations, balance routes, reduce emissions, and improve customer satisfaction through data-driven planning and adaptive execution.
August 04, 2025
This evergreen guide distills robust strategies for labeling and annotating geospatial imagery, focusing on consistency, traceability, quality control, and scalable workflows that empower reliable machine learning outcomes across diverse geographic contexts and data sources.
August 07, 2025
This evergreen guide explores how constraint programming, combined with geospatial data, yields resilient facility location solutions that comply with regulatory and environmental constraints while optimizing logistics, costs, and accessibility.
July 23, 2025
Geographically weighted regression offers nuanced insights by estimating local relationships, revealing how urban and rural contexts shape the strength and direction of associations between variables in diverse datasets.
August 09, 2025
Federated geospatial learning enables multiple stakeholders to train robust location-aware models by exchanging model updates rather than raw data, preserving privacy, reducing data governance friction, and supporting continual learning across diverse datasets and jurisdictions.
August 09, 2025
This evergreen guide explains how spatial feature importance reveals regional influences on model predictions, offering practical steps, visualization strategies, and interpretations for data scientists and policymakers alike.
August 08, 2025
A practical, evergreen guide to building stable geospatial analytics environments with containers, automated workflows, and shared data access conventions for reliable, scalable research and production use.
July 19, 2025
Building reproducible spatial experiments requires standardized protocols, transparent data handling, and rigorous benchmarking to ensure fair comparisons across geospatial models and analysis pipelines.
August 08, 2025
Geospatially weighted modeling uncovers nuanced, place-specific interactions often hidden by broad averages, enabling analysts to detect regional patterns, tailor interventions, and improve decision making with locally grounded insights.
July 22, 2025
A practical guide to building reusable geospatial courses that blend essential theory with immersive, project-based data science exercises, enabling scalable learning paths for diverse audiences.
July 18, 2025